Shampoo to add volume to straight hair without weighing hair down

I have extremely fine hair and I wear it straight. Which shampoo would be best to use that would give it some type of volume but not weigh it down? Thank you!

There are a variety of shampoos in the market which promise to add volume to your hair. You will have to examine all of them before you are able to decide on which shampoo best suits you. In addition to this you can also try some simple home remedies to help your hair look thicker. You will find that with regular oil massage the hair does get thicker. This naturally enough adds volume to the hair. You can use ordinary coconut oil that has been warmed a little, to massage your scalp. You can also make this medicated by adding various natural products to it. For example, you can boil pieces of dried Indian gooseberry in the oil and use this oil to massage your hair. You can also boil pieces dried lemon peel in the oil since this helps hair look healthy and shiny. Try to avoid washing your hair regularly since this causes breakage. You should make a practice of applying various types of packs during the week, to make your hair healthier and thicker. You can mix some henna powder with tea water and leave it overnight in an iron skillet. This can be applied in the morning on the hair and then washed off an hour later. Similarly, you can also boil the powder of dried Indian gooseberry in some water and leave this out overnight. This, when applied regularly on the hair an hour before you bath, can help your hair look shinier and thicker.

Avoid combing out your hair too often since this can cause breakage. Also, you should try and avoid using any treatment on your hair - like perming or straightening since both these use a lot of heat or very strong chemicals which can damage hair and cause hair fall. Ensure that your hair is always covered when you go out so that you can protect it from the elements and from the pollution. You can also make some changes to your diet and switch to healthy food like fruits and vegetables in place of unhealthy food items. Avoid oily food items and drink lots of water. You will find that regularly following these steps will help your hair look thicker and healthier. You can also consider getting your hair cut in a layered style, since this will definitely add volume to your hair. You can also consult a good beautician who will be able to advise you on which style will best suit you. Wearing it straight will only emphasize its fine texture.
